    Tried a new restaurant tonight Saks Thai Cuisine. We tried Pad Thai, Chicken Panang Curry and Siam Rolls. IMPORTANT: they are not seating inside today. We didn't know that so we were disappointed (we were hoping to sit down) but decided to order anyway. In general the food was hot and delicious. Siam Rolls were a bit burnt (see picture) but the insides were the best we have had in a while. Chicken & Shrimp Pad Thai was delicious but not as spicy as I normally like it. The person who took the order recommend 3/5 but next time I will go with 4/5. NOTE: I would not get shrimp again because some shrimp tails were still on I had to double check before eating. Delicious but unnecessarily messy. Chicken Panang Curry was perfect ; although not enough rice. Service: limited to person taking the order in the lobby of the restaurant. Honestly, when Linda and I first walked in she was not very friendly or welcoming. I came close to walking out while we explored the menu, however, we decided to give her a chance after another customer noticed her attitude towards us and spoke up. Somehow that helped and the dynamic changed. In summary: as much as I enjoyed the food. The interaction with the person who took the order was unpleasant enough that I will probably not be back for a while. Spending $60 for dinner where you can't sit down and not be treated in a friendly way doesn't make sense to me when there are other options. Message to owner: the person taking the order for your restaurant is representing your restaurant so if that person is not friendly to your customers it will impact return business. The food was delicious so I will be back. I am hoping the customer service experience is better next time.

    As someone who lives in the city and goes to the parent restaurant Khongs Thai Cuisine this was a place I wanted to go to but to be frank it's just the distance and than you have to wonder if it's worth a visit. I would say yes and no. It's located in a small strip mall, you could easily pass it if you don't know the area. I had no idea what this place looked like inside or what to expect. Some said be prepared to be ignored and wait.. guess what it's true. Now it was a Tuesday night and we made a reservation at 6 pm for about eight people. There was another table of the same amount they got served and what not and left way before we did. The place was not that busy but it just seemed forever to order or reorder anything than the wait for the food seemed to take FOREVER. This was a Tuesday not a weekend but whatever. Maybe they got hit up with take out orders. Everyone seemed happy with their dishes like the Tom Kar Soup, Fresh Spring Rolls, Siam Rolls, Pad Thai, Duck dish and more. Everything was fresh and tasty. I went the safe route and got the Chicken Pad Thai they give you a lot I had enough for lunch the next day. Than the Siam Rolls with that Chili Dipping Sauce it was great. I'll have to try other things and the pork dumplings looked fabulous. All in all the food is worth the trip. The inside is lovely all the Thai art; the color scheme of the place inside was all light cream/coffee colors. Staff is pleasant enough, but when telling the server numerous times one person could not have peanuts something came out with it.. whatever. Service is slow... and yes you may wait for a bit for things. Is it worth a return visit yes as long as someone else is driving. Ha ha... Highway from the city is 20 minutes if you take Monroe about 30 minutes. Shared parking lot. The place is attractive and the food is great I give it a 4.5, service is about 3.5 due to being ignored and the wait. Give it a shot.....
